Interestingly, it appears that the game's own anti-cheat software might be responsible for the issue. GenBurten from [[Companies/DarkZero|DarkZero]] was the first to be affected, experiencing an unexpected ability to see enemy players through walls amid a match. Subsequently, ImperialHal from [[Companies/TSM|TSM]] encountered unintentional aimbotting.
